## Algorithm Reference
| Algorithm | Best For | Budget | Key Settings |
|-----------|----------|--------|--------------|
| CMA-ES | Continuous, noisy | 100+ | sigma0, popsize |
| Bayesian (GP-EI) | Expensive evals | <50 | n_initial, acquisition |
| NSGA-II | Multi-objective | 200+ | pop_size, crossover |
| Nelder-Mead | Local refinement | <20 | initial_simplex |
| TPE | Mixed continuous/discrete | 50+ | n_startup_trials |
